Investors are expressing growing concerns as allegations of scams and security breaches push the cryptocurrency market into a state of instability. The recent controversies surrounding Shiba Inu (SHIB) and Pepe (PEPE), two popular meme coins, have led to an increased sense of investor caution Pawswap’s alleged attack Shibarium and Pepe’s Telegram hack have sparked. This has led to both currencies plummeting to their lowest values in the past 30 days.

Claims of Scams Surrounding Shibarium

A significant member of the Shibarium tech team, Digarch, recently drew attention to a warning issued by Shibarium tech admin DaVinci. DaVinci issued a cautionary note regarding a project named ‘Pawswap’, accusing it of orchestrating attacks on the Shibarium network. The community was advised to steer clear of the project, with DaVinci labelling it a ‘Scam or Shitcoin’. Digarch, however, clarified that Pawswap is separate from Pawzone, a legitimate project preparing to launch an NFT marketplace, Pawzaar, on Shibarium.

Another user on a social platform contested the scam allegations, pointing out that blockchain security firm Certik had awarded Pawswap a silver KYC badge, potentially instilling confidence among potential investors.

Pepe’s Telegram Breach Adds to Market Instability

Adding to the market’s instability, the Telegram account of Pepe Coin recently fell victim to a security breach. An unauthorized user known as ‘lordkeklol’ took control of the account, promoting scams and other crypto projects, thereby tarnishing the coin’s reputation. The Pepe team urged the community to report this account and assured that future updates would come exclusively from their official account.

Earlier, the PEPE coin had already experienced internal discord and significant token theft, with over 16 trillion PEPE tokens stolen and transferred into various centralized exchanges. This resulted in a nearly 19% drop in trading volume, raising fears of further decline.

Market Reactions and the Mood of Investors

While the allegations of scams and security breaches have not been definitively proven, they have significantly influenced market behavior. Prices of Shiba Inu have fallen from a 24-hour high of $0.000007418 to a 30-day low of $0.000007207. Similarly, the value of PEPE has dropped from an intra-day high of $0.0000007261 to a 30-day low of $0.0000006785. These developments suggest a bearish sentiment among investors.

The recent controversies surrounding SHIB and PEPE underscore the importance of due diligence. Shibarium’s lead developer, Shytoshi Kusama, has consistently stressed the need for research, a sentiment that seems more relevant than ever amidst these turbulent market conditions.
